Sun conjunct Descendant is the same as Sun opposite Ascendant. The Descendant is the cusp of your 7th house, the relationship house. When someone's Sun lands there, coupling up feels natural, easy, like you're both on the same page about wanting to be together.
This is a very magnetic and strong aspect in synastry. Not all Suns hitting your Descendant will make you feel this way. Other contacts bring you together. But when this aspect is there, it's powerful.
This aspect shows up constantly in long-term relationships. Any personal planet conjunct the Descendant creates a "this could be it" feeling, but especially the luminaries (Sun and Moon) or Venus. It's not just attraction. It's actual, practical consideration of the other person as the perfect mate. Inner pull toward their qualities. Strong resonance that screams "the one."
Having another person's Sun in your 7th house is also very prominent, even if it's not conjunct the Descendant. Sun anywhere in the 7th creates that "we belong together" feeling, the sense that you're complementary opposites who fit. If the conjunction is from the 6th house side, I'd measure a conjunction for up to about 6 degrees.
